Background and Early Foundations

Ren Zhengfei was born in Zhenning County, Guizhou Province, China. He graduated from Chongqing Institute of Civil Engineering and Architecture in 1963. Ren served in the People’s Liberation Army’s Engineering Corps, where he contributed to significant infrastructure projects. After retiring from the military in 1983, he worked at the Shenzhen South Sea Oil Corporation. In 1987, with a capital of CNY21,000, he founded Huawei Technologies in Shenzhen, focusing initially on reselling private branch exchange (PBX) switches.

Career Milestones and Impact

Year

Milestone

1987

Founded Huawei Technologies in Shenzhen, China.

1993

Launched Huawei's first digital telephone switch, marking its entry into telecom manufacturing.

2004

Expanded Huawei's operations globally, establishing partnerships and R&D centers worldwide.

2012

Huawei became the world's largest telecom equipment manufacturer, surpassing Ericsson.

2019

Faced international scrutiny and sanctions, yet maintained growth and innovation.

  • Huawei’s Revenue (2023): Over $100 billion USD
  • Global Presence: Operations in more than 170 countries
  • Employee Count: Approximately 195,000 worldwide
  • R&D Investment: Over 10% of annual revenue reinvested into research and development

Leadership Style and Influence

Ren Zhengfei is known for his strategic foresight and resilience. He emphasizes the importance of innovation, investing heavily in R&D to keep Huawei at the forefront of technology. Despite facing geopolitical challenges, Ren has maintained a focus on long-term growth and global collaboration.

Legacy and Future Focus

Under Ren’s leadership, Huawei has transformed from a small reseller into a global tech giant. He continues to advocate for technological advancement and aims to position Huawei as a leader in emerging fields like AI and cloud computing.
